Like Microsoft and Google, Slack owner Salesforce is incorporating an artificial intelligence chatbot into its workplace software to automatically write simple messages and summarize meetings.
ChatGPT is coming to Slack. On Tuesday, Salesforce-owned Slack announced a new artificial intelligence app that will help you compose responses to colleagues "in seconds."
Those with access to the app can click on the three-dot icon in the thread and tap "Draft Answer" instead of typing the answer themselves. It's still unclear how detailed these responses will be, and whether they might be a little weird at times. Of course, you can edit any reply to better fit the conversation, but I honestly feel like I can type a reply in the time it takes to let the ChatGPT team write it for me.
In addition, the ChatGPT Slack bot will help you find answers "on any project or topic" using its artificial intelligence-based research tools, and summarize channels or topics to keep you up to date on what's going on at work. This news comes as part of Salesforce's broader announcement about Einstein GPT, a proprietary version of OpenAI's ChatGPT model for CRM (customer relationship management) software systems. According to Salesforce, Einstein GPT incorporates artificial intelligence technologies from both Salesforce and OpenAI, allowing it to generate emails that salespeople can send to customers, compose responses to customer questions, and create "targeted content" for marketers.
Salesforce's entry into the AI-powered tools market isn't all that surprising. Several other companies, including Microsoft, Google and Meta, are also looking at incorporating AI into their products - and the competition is clearly intensifying. Just a day before this announcement, Microsoft unveiled CoPilot AI for Microsoft 365, which can also write customized emails or messages for customers, as well as create marketing content. Google has also integrated AI tools into its productivity apps, including Meet and Spaces.
